The genCART Watch X is a refreshingly simple take on wearable technology. Rather than badgering you with endless notifications, it acts as a quiet companion focusing on long-term health metrics and core productivity. With Grade 5 titanium housing and standard health sensors like SpO2 and ECG, it provides accurate health diagnostics wrapped in premium design.
